Q1: What is C8051F834-GS? A1: C8051F834-GS is a microcontroller from Silicon Labs' C8051F83x family, specifically designed for embedded applications.
Q2: What are the key features of C8051F834-GS? A2: Some key features include an 8-bit MCU core, 25 MHz maximum operating frequency, 8 kB Flash memory, 256 bytes RAM, multiple communication interfaces, and analog peripherals.
Q3: What technical solutions can C8051F834-GS be used for? A3: C8051F834-GS can be used in various technical solutions such as industrial automation, consumer electronics, smart home devices, motor control systems, and sensor-based applications.
Q4: How can I program C8051F834-GS? A4: C8051F834-GS can be programmed using the Silicon Labs Integrated Development Environment (IDE) called Simplicity Studio. It supports both assembly and C programming languages.
Q5: Can I interface C8051F834-GS with other devices? A5: Yes, C8051F834-GS has multiple communication interfaces like UART, SPI, and I2C, which allow easy interfacing with other devices such as sensors, displays, and external memory.
Q6: Does C8051F834-GS support analog functions? A6: Yes, C8051F834-GS has built-in analog peripherals like ADC (Analog-to-Digital Converter) and DAC (Digital-to-Analog Converter), enabling measurement and generation of analog signals.
Q7: What is the power supply requirement for C8051F834-GS? A7: C8051F834-GS operates at a supply voltage range of 2.7V to 5.25V, making it compatible with various power sources like batteries and regulated power supplies.
Q8: Can I use C8051F834-GS in low-power applications? A8: Yes, C8051F834-GS offers several power-saving features such as multiple sleep modes, wake-up timers, and low-power peripherals, making it suitable for low-power applications.
Q9: Is C8051F834-GS suitable for real-time applications? A9: Yes, C8051F834-GS has a fast interrupt response time, which makes it suitable for real-time applications that require quick event handling and precise timing.
Q10: Are there any development boards available for C8051F834-GS? A10: Yes, Silicon Labs provides development boards specifically designed for C8051F83x family, including C8051F850DK development kit, which can be used for rapid prototyping and evaluation.
